Australian Peach Melba Bread Recipe

Australian Peach Melba Bread Recipe With Raspberry Sauce is a delightful and flavorsome recipe that combines the sweetness of peaches with the creaminess of melba sauce.

Ingredients

  • 10 peaches sliced
  • 3 cups water
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• 1 cup sugar
  • 2 pints ice cream Vanilla
  • 4 cups fresh raspberries
  • 1/4 cup confectioners' sugar

Instructions

Prepare the Peaches:

  • a. Wash and dry 10 peaches.
  • b. Slice the peaches into thin, even slices.
  • c. Set aside.

Make the Peach Syrup:

  • a. In a saucepan, combine 3 cups of water and 1 tablespoon of lemon juice.
  • b. Add 1 cup of sugar to the saucepan and stir well.
  • c. Place the saucepan over medium heat and bring the mixture to a simmer, stirring occasionally.
  • d. Simmer for about 5 minutes or until the sugar has dissolved completely.
  • e. Remove the saucepan from heat and let the peach syrup cool to room temperature.

Prepare the Melba Sauce:

  • a. In a blender or food processor, puree 4 cups of fresh raspberries until smooth.
  • b. Strain the raspberry puree through a fine-mesh sieve to remove the seeds.
  • c. Add ¼ cup of confectioners' sugar to the strained raspberry puree and mix well.
  • d. Set the melba sauce aside.

Assemble the Peach Melba:

  • a. Place a scoop of vanilla ice cream into serving bowls or dessert glasses.
  • b. Arrange a generous amount of sliced peaches on top of the ice cream.
  • c. Drizzle the peach syrup over the peaches and ice cream.
  • d. Spoon the melba sauce over the peaches.
  • e. Garnish with fresh raspberries and a sprinkle of confectioners' sugar.

Serve and Enjoy:

  • a. Serve the Australian Peach Melba immediately.
  • b. You can enjoy it as is or with a dollop of whipped cream if desired.

Notes

Use ripe and juicy peaches for maximum flavor.
Allow the peach syrup to cool completely before drizzling it over the dessert.
Chill the serving bowls or dessert glasses in the refrigerator before assembling the Peach Melba for a refreshing touch.
For a twist, try grilling the peach slices for a smoky flavor.
Add a splash of almond extract to the peach syrup for an extra layer of aroma.
Top the Peach Melba with crushed nuts, such as toasted almonds or pecans, for added texture.
If fresh raspberries are not available, you can use frozen raspberries to make the melba sauce.
